"Bobby, did you put on your sunscreen?" 

(Yes, I was Bobby to my family growing up. It's still what my sisters call me.) 

As a pale, redheaded kid growing up in California, I heard that sentence from my mother a thousand times growing up. And I needed the reminding, too, since I almost never had put it on before my mom asked. 

I'm sure my mom didn't love needing to remind me over and over to put on my sunscreen (or put away the dishes, or do my homework, or...) One of the many reasons to celebrate moms this Mother's Day is their dogged persistence in so many ways: teaching us over and over to choose the good, to recognize beauty, and to be mindful of hazards. 

This week at Grace, we're going to look at a story of a mother's persistence toward Jesus for the sake of her daughter. This mom shows us what faith looks like in action, and how Jesus responds to faith from an unlikely place. 

Looking forward to growing in persistent faith with you all!
